Once the tickets are secured, the journey begins, with many opting for the efficient 6 train that deposits passengers just steps away from the iconic façade. Traffic congestion on the Major Deegan Expressway can test the patience of those driving, making public transport the preferred choice for the environmentally conscious and the time-savvy alike.

Strategic Seating for Optimal Enjoyment

The location of your seat dictates the entire evening. Upper deck enthusiasts enjoy a panoramic view of the entire field, perfect for tracking the arc of a home run. Meanwhile, seats down the first or third base line offer an intimate view of the pitcher’s duel and the infield defense. Understanding the nuances of the venue allows fans to choose seats that align with their personal preferences, whether that is proximity to the action or a wider perspective of the stadium architecture.
